研究概览

简要总结

Teaching modalities that integrate digital educational technologies, such as educational games, dummies and simulated environments, develop critical thinking in students, the absorption of significant learning and the consequent reduction in the exposure of patients to the damage associated with health care. Thus, this study will evaluate the effectiveness of simulation strategies and digital educational platforms in the teaching-learning process, in self-confidence and its implications for the physiological variables and stressful feelings of undergraduate nursing students. Our hypothesis is that students submitted to the use of digital platforms will present lower levels of self-efficacy, capacity for clinical judgment and retention of knowledge when compared to those who were submitted to the simulation strategy.

详细描述

The study will be carried out in the simulation laboratory of two Higher Education Institutions, one public and the other private in the city of Brasília, Brazil. The sample will consist of 100 students randomized into an experimental group (n=50) and a control group (n=50). Students enrolled in the undergraduate nursing course, aged 18 years or over, will be eligible; have minimal approval in a discipline related to the content of "Nursing Care for Adult Patients". Students who work actively in the scenario of patient care in critical and risk situations will be excluded; members of the Academic League of Realistic Health Simulation and those with prior training in the health field. It is expected that nursing students, through active and innovative strategies, will be able to obtain and retain greater knowledge, raise levels of self-efficacy and clinical judgment, for their performance in clinical practice.

Clinical Judgment

时间窗: Applied sixty days after the intervention

Evaluation of the development of clinical reasoning of nursing students. The instrument Lasater Clinical Judgment Rubric (LCJR) - Brazilian Version will be used. It assesses 11 dimensions at four levels of clinical judgment (recognition, interpretation, response, reflection). The total score ranges from 11 to 44, where the "initial" level generates one point, the "in development" level generates two points, the "proficient" level generates three points and the "exemplary" level generates four points .

Self-efficacy (Baseline)

时间窗: Applied before the intervention

Assessment of satisfaction, learning, individual performance after educational actions. A self-efficacy scale will be used. IT'S self-applicable and has 13 items related to beliefs about their own abilities, motivation for action, coping with obstacles, predisposition to challenge, openness to experience, resilience in the face of failures, the influence of initial success on the the final success of an activity and the history of previous successes. These items are represented by a Likert-type scale of agreement, containing five points, in which 1 represents the participant's total disagreement and 5 the total agreement. Scores above 2.5 indicate that participants feel very capable.
